Business: Cameco Corp.NYSE: CCJWith its subsidiaries, engages primarily in the exploration, development, mining, refining, conversion, and fabrication of uranium as fuel for nuclear power reactors in Canada and internationally. The company operates in four segments: Uranium, Fuel Services, Electricity, and Gold.Reasons to be interested:1. Nuclear power is more and more becoming the most plausible clean, cheap energy option for countries everywhere. Nuclear power is climbing up the ranks and Cameco is in a good position to benefit from nuclear expansion.2. The company's cash flow production and free cash flow are both strong and rapidly increasing. Sales and earnings growth have been monstrous as well. In fiscal 2006, the company produced $418.02 million in cash flow. Over the past four quarters, the company has produced $756.99 million.3. In the most recent quarter the company bought back $222.85 million of stock; the company has also been paying off debt and expanding its cash position. The company currently has $598.47 million in cash and $694.16 million in debt.Main risk:Political pressure could keep nuclear plant expansion down which would put a halt to Cameco's growth. Cameco is not a cheap stock with a P/E of 35+, if political pressure on nuclear power really increases worldwide, Cameco's stock would likely be hit a good amount. http://www.pencils2.com/companysummaries/cameco.html
